definitely turn off beams, bluetooth, wifi and direct push if you are not using them, they will chew up your battery.

Direct Push is toggled on and off in your comm manager. it's only used for MS Exchange server and Outlook. Absolutely not necessary even if you do have outlook set-up and it eats a ton of battery since it's always checking the server for new messages.
